Changelog — Meridial Sync 7.0. Defaults changed for calendar conflict handling. Previously, conflicting edits to the same event were queued for manual review; the new default auto-resolves using the most recent modification timestamp, with the losing version stored in the conflict archive for thirty days. Tenants upgraded before the freeze keep the old behavior until opt-in. No action needed for the release; rollback is config-only. New defaults ship as follows.

deployment values, hahip-kajep:
HOLAX_PIN=4003
HOLAX_METRICS_HOST=metrics.holax.zemvarworks.internal
HOLAX_LOG_LEVEL=warn
HOLAX_TENANT=fraael

**Ticket: CSV import wizard drops quoted headers**

Plugin authors: the Fernwheel import wizard strips quotes from header rows before passing them to your column-mapping hooks, so headers containing commas arrive split. Workaround: pre-sanitize headers in your manifest. Fix targeted for the next minor release. Do not rely on raw header order until then. Reference the build token below when reporting.

pipeline stamp: htk6_35e0c9

Build agents at Fennelworks sync against the Tollgate NTP pool. If skew exceeds 200ms, the Brindlecast scheduler rejects artifact signatures and builds fail with CLOCK_MISMATCH. Don't restart the agent; run the skew probe first and file it under infra-clock. Re-signing requires unlocking the agent keystore, which asks for the team recovery passphrase. Use the one below.

vault phrase of kawef-yahop = wenir-jorox-druys-belion-kelion-lamvan-frawyn-norael-julox-raleth-rusax-oliys-holael

Handover Note — Merrow Licensing Dispute

To the Board, from outgoing Director Alys Venn to incoming Director Carel Moss.

The dispute with Merrow Technologies over the Sablewood codec licence remains unresolved. Our counsel considers their royalty recalculation claim overstated, but settlement discussions are constructive. Carel should review the correspondence file and attend the mediation session next month. Provisioning is adequate. The confidential strategic note relevant to this matter appears below.

internal memo for kaduf-baduf: Only 35 of the 378 pilot accounts renewed Holir, so a churn review is set for June 11. Eliielax Group is in early talks to buy Silaelix Group for about $142.1 million.